Whenever I'm Afraid . . .
by Deborah Ann Belka

Whenever I am afraid
and fear comes my way
I stop what I am doing
and to my Lord, I pray.

I won't allow my fears,
to take away my calm
for in Jesus I do trust
to be my soothing balm.

In God's loving-kindness,
He sent me His peace
and Jesus died for me
to see it wouldn't cease.

I won't allow my fears,
to influence my serenity
for it is in my Lord
I find my true identity.

Whenever I am afraid,
and fear comes my way
I put my trust in my Lord
to take them all away.

~~~~~~~~~~~~~~

Psalm 56:3
King James Version

"What time I am afraid,
I will trust in thee"
